[empathy] Allow accounts_dialog_has_pending_change to return a NULL TpAccount



commit 24a3d8e3e4cee7272cc26d17ca3bdb8029581304
Author: Guillaume Desmottes <guillaume desmottes collabora co uk>
Date:   Mon Nov 2 17:08:27 2009 +0000

    Allow accounts_dialog_has_pending_change to return a NULL TpAccount
    
    That way we can warn user when he is about to lose his newly created
    account (#598550).

 src/empathy-accounts-dialog.c |   37 ++++++++++++++++++++++++-------------
 1 files changed, 24 insertions(+), 13 deletions(-)
